Julián Terrón scored a first-half hat-trick (2', 16', 45+3') as Metropolitan FA beat North Leeward Predators 4-0 in the CFU Club Shield Round of 16 at Larry Gomes Stadium.

AI SummaryJulián Terrón hat-trick fires Metropolitan FA into CFU Club Shield quarterfinals
Metropolitan FA dismantled North Leeward Predators FC 4-0 at Larry Gomes Stadium in Arima, Trinidad and Tobago, on 26 July, with Julián Terrón scoring a 43-minute hat-trick that effectively ended the Round of 16 tie inside the first half.
Puerto Rico's Metropolitan FA arrived as one of the more experienced sides in the competition and their quality told from the opening exchanges. Terrón struck inside two minutes, added a second in the 16th minute, and completed his treble in first-half stoppage time (45+3') to send his side into the break 3-0 up. Jorge Rivera rounded off the scoring with a fourth goal in the 86th minute.
How it unfolded
Terrón needed less than 120 seconds to make his mark. The Metropolitan forward capitalised on a defensive lapse inside the box and finished calmly to give his side the lead. The Puerto Rican champions doubled their advantage in the 16th minute when Terrón struck again, this time converting from close range after a swift attacking move.
North Leeward Predators, who had beaten SCSA Eagles 3-1 in the First Round on 25 July to reach this stage, struggled to find a foothold. Their best spell of possession came midway through the first half, but they could not turn it into a clear chance.
Terrón completed his hat-trick in the third minute of added time before the interval, meeting a cross with a composed finish that left the North Leeward goalkeeper with no chance. The game was effectively over by half-time at 3-0.
Metropolitan controlled the second half without pressing for a rout. Substitute Jorge Rivera added a fourth in the 86th minute, turning home from inside the area to put a final gloss on the scoreline.

What it means
Metropolitan FA advanced to the quarterfinals, where they defeated Helenites SC 2-1 on 28 July to reach the semifinals against Delfines del Este FC. The winner of that semifinal will qualify for the 2026 CONCACAF Caribbean Cup, with the tournament's two finalists earning a place in the regional competition. North Leeward Predators' debut CFU Club Shield campaign ended at the Round of 16 after a promising First Round victory over SCSA Eagles.
